Monster Lairs
Monster lairs are fictional locations where some great or minor fictional beast dwells. These may be great nests, cave systems, hunting grounds, or other areas. They may be home to great beasts, swarms, sleeping titans, or other creatures. Often fictional beast dens will have skeletons, bones, or blood decorating the ground and providing clues to adventurers that it may be better just to turn around and leave.

Designing Fictional Monster Lairs

When designing monster lairs, consider the biology and ecology of the animal. Is it a lone hunter, or a pack animal? Is it carnivorous, or something else? And what is its’ prey? Is there sign left behind in the form of tracks, markings, scat, trophy kills, or other displays?

A den does not have to be a natural area, it could be the sewers, an abandoned building, or the warm engine room of a derelict spaceship.
